BBC to Show FA Cup First Qualifying Round Live

The FA Cup first qualifying round tie between Knowle and Worcester City will be shown live on the BBC next month. The match kicks off at 12:30 BST on Saturday, 5 September and will be broadcast across BBC iPlayer, Red Button, BBC Football's YouTube channel and the BBC Sport website.

This will be the 10th year the BBC has broadcast matches from the qualifying stage, with ties from each round available all the way through to the final at Wembley in May.

Knowle, who have earned back-to-back promotions to reach Step Five of the English football league system, are competing in the FA Cup for the first time. Worcester City, who play two divisions higher in Step Three, have a notable FA Cup pedigree, having beaten Coventry City in a shock 2-1 victory 12 years ago and defeated Liverpool, then in the Second Division, in 1959.
